Full Job Description
Job Title: Arista Wireless SME
Location: Remote Work From Home

Role: 90 Day Contract to Hire (Potential to convert from Contract to Full Time Employee with benefits) Position Overview

The Arista Wireless SME is a senior, hands-on technical leadership role within a professional IT services organization, serving as the technical authority for enterprise wireless architecture. This position demands expertise in Arista's next-generation wireless platforms, with demonstrable experience designing, deploying, and supporting Arista Cognitive Wi-Fi and CloudVision Cognitive Unified Edge (CV-CUE) solutions.

The role blends solution design, field deployment leadership, pre-sales technical scoping, and escalation support, operating as both an architect and hands-on technical mentor to delivery teams.

Core Responsibilities
Wireless Architecture & Design
  • Serve as the primary wireless domain expert, with deep, hands-on experience in Arista Wireless architecture, hardware, and cloud-managed technologies
  • Design enterprise-grade wireless solutions leveraging Arista's cognitive networking capabilities, including:
    • CloudVision Cognitive Unified Edge (CV-CUE) centralized management, orchestration, and AI/ML-driven automation planes
    • Cognitive Wi-Fi platforms that provide data-driven telemetry, real-time analytics, and automatic optimization of wireless connections as network conditions evolve
    • Multi-radio, multifunction AP deployments with support for cutting-edge standards such as Wi-Fi 6E and Wi-Fi 7, zero-touch onboarding, and high-density coverage models
  • Develop high-level and low-level wireless designs (HLDs/LLDs) incorporating:
    • RF design, capacity planning, AP placement, and cognitive tuning mechanisms
    • Zero Trust and WIPS security configurations integrated with cloud orchestration
    • Flexible data path options and scalable control-plane architectures inherent to CloudVision's cognitive approach
Deployment Leadership & Technical Execution
  • Lead and direct wireless deployment efforts in customer environments and ensure alignment to Arista cognitive design principles
  • Mentor and guide junior engineers through:
    • Zero-touch provisioning and onboarding of Arista AP platforms via CV-CUE
    • Implementation of AI/ML-enabled analytics and automated remediation features
    • Integration of AP connectivity with hosted identity management and external NAC solutions
  • Validate configurations and deployments to ensure stable, optimized performance across cognitive AP platforms and centralized CloudVision management
Pre-Sales Scoping & Technical Support
  • Participate in pre-sales scoping calls with sales and delivery leadership
  • Provide detailed input on:
    • The effort required to transition customers from legacy Wi-Fi environments to Arista, Cisco, Aruba and other OEM's or managed architectures
    • Level of Effort (LOE) estimation for discovery, design, deployment, optimization, and cutover phases
  • Validate technical assumptions for proposals and SOWs based on real experience with Arista cloud-native wireless technologies
Escalation & Customer Assurance
  • Serve as the escalation point for delivery issues related to:
    • Wi-Fi behavior under load and real-world spectrum conditions
    • Automation orchestration failures or troubleshooting of AI/ML-driven recommendations
    • Cross-domain issues spanning wired/wireless convergence and identity enforcement
  • Engage directly in customer escalation calls to remediate issues, restore confidence, and guide recovery
